日本免费全黄少妇一区二区三区-高清无码一区二区三区四区-欧美中文字幕日韩在线观看-国产福利诱惑在线网站-国产中文字幕一区在线-亚洲欧美精品日韩一区-久久国产精品国产精品国产-国产精久久久久久一区二区三区-欧美亚洲国产精品久久久久

注冊表 基礎(chǔ)知識( 四 )


4.HKEY_CLASSES_ROOT
包含注冊的所有ole信息和文檔類型,是從 hkey_local_machinesoftwareclasses復(fù)制的 。根據(jù)在 Windows 98 中文版中安裝的應(yīng)用程序的擴展名 , 該根鍵指明其文件類型的名稱。
5.HKEY_LOCAL_MACHINE
該根鍵存放本地計算機硬件數(shù)據(jù) , 此根鍵下的子關(guān)鍵字包括在 SYSTEM.DAT 中 , 用來提供 HKEY_LOCAL_MACHINE 所需的信息 , 或者在遠(yuǎn)程計算機中可訪問的一組鍵中 。
該根鍵中的許多子鍵與 System.ini 文件中設(shè)置項類似 。
6.HKEY_DYN_DATA
該根鍵存放了系統(tǒng)在運行時動態(tài)數(shù)據(jù),此數(shù)據(jù)在每次顯示時都是變化的,因此,此根鍵下的信息沒有放在注冊表中 。
認(rèn)識鍵和子鍵
注冊表通過鍵和子鍵來管理各種信息 。但是,注冊表中的所有信息是以各種形式的鍵值項數(shù)據(jù)保存下來 。在注冊表編輯器右窗格中,保存的都是鍵值項數(shù)據(jù) 。這些鍵值項數(shù)據(jù)可分為如下三種類型:
1. 字符串值
在注冊表中,字符串值一般用來表示文件的描述、硬件的標(biāo)識等 。通常它由字母和數(shù)字組成,最大長度不能超過 255 個字符 。比如“ D:pwin98trident ”即為鍵值名“ a ”的鍵值,它是一種字符串值類型的 。同樣地,“ ba ”也為鍵值名“ MRUList ”的鍵值 。通過鍵值名、鍵值就可以組成一種鍵值項數(shù)據(jù),這就相當(dāng)于 Win.ini 、 Ssyt-em.ini 文件中小節(jié)下的設(shè)置行 。其實,使用注冊表編輯器將這些鍵值項數(shù)據(jù)導(dǎo)出后,其形式與 INI 文件中的設(shè)置行完全相同 。
2. 二進制值
在注冊表中,二進制值是沒有長度限制的,可以是任意個字節(jié)長 。在注冊表編輯器中,二進制以十六進制的方式顯示出來 。比如鍵值名 Wizard 的鍵值“ 80 00 00 00 ”就是一個二進制 。
3. DWORD 值
DWORD 值是一個 32 位( 4 個字節(jié),即雙字)長度的數(shù)值 。在注冊表編輯器中,您將發(fā)現(xiàn)系統(tǒng)會以十六進制的方式顯示 DWORD 值 。在編輯 DWORD 數(shù)值時,可以選擇用十進制還是 16 進制的方式進行輸入 。
另外:對注冊表信息的注冊和修改,一般由以下幾點實現(xiàn):
安裝Win9X時,由安裝程序注冊系統(tǒng)信息;
安裝應(yīng)用程序時,由安裝程序注冊該程序的配置信息;
添加新硬件時,由系統(tǒng)即插即用功能監(jiān)測并注冊的信息;
通過控制面板或?qū)傩詫υ捒蚋淖兿到y(tǒng)屬性與設(shè)置而實現(xiàn)的信息變更;
通過注冊表編輯器對信息進行手工修改.

DOS下維護注冊表的高級技巧
現(xiàn)在隨著電腦應(yīng)用知識的普及,我想,很多朋友對WINDOWS注冊表的修改已經(jīng)有不少經(jīng)驗和心得 。在圖形界面下對注冊表的維護和修改,就不必再提了,但有時候,我們可能會遇到更辣手的事情,如由于人為錯誤操作或者惡性病毒感染而使系統(tǒng)切底崩潰,不能進入WINDOWS圖形界面時,我們對此是否只有重裝這種方法呢?本文將就在DOS下面盡量挽救系統(tǒng)這方面作出闡述 。
一、使用scanreg/restore

我想這種方法大家也比較熟悉了,只要在DOS界面下輸入該命令,就可以在最近的5個注冊表備份里恢復(fù),如果幸運的話,系統(tǒng)就可以馬上恢復(fù) 。但,事實上,用這種方法有個致命的缺陷就是你只有最近5天的注冊表備份可以選擇 。因為控制著自動備份的scanreg.exe只會在每天第一次啟動電腦時備份,如果哪天你安裝的程序或者對注冊表的修改比較多,那么你的努力就大多白費了 。這種方法就正如是眉毛胡子一起抓,正確和錯誤的都一起改掉,是否能為恢復(fù)系統(tǒng)幫上忙,總有一種聽天由命的感覺 。所以,筆者鼓勵大家使用第二種方法 。
二、使用DOS界面的regedit.exe

如果把scanreg/restore比作是一刀切的話,這種方法更像是一次高明的外科手術(shù),只一矢中的地針對病,把錯誤修復(fù)而完全不影響注冊表的其他健康部分 。這樣,我們就能在最大限度上保留我們的工作成果了 。使用regedit.exe對注冊表實行局部修改的思路是:首先,把注冊表里有嫌疑的分支導(dǎo)出;然后,使用edit對它進行分析和修改;最后,把健康的分支重新導(dǎo)入注冊表里 。好了,我們來看看整個過程的具體操作 。

推薦閱讀